First, you have to tune to Drop B: Low to high B F# B E G# C#. Get 12–60, 12–62, or 13–62 strings for that. Important: Drop B is not B standard. Drop B lets you play one-finger power chords on the lowest three strings. Use the Bridge Pockup on your Schecter, with Volume and Tone knobs on the guitar to full. And the main mistake is usually using too much amp gain and bass. For this kind of tone you want: tight boost (Tubescreamer with Drive Zero, Level Max in front) → high-gain amp → controlled low end → lots of pick attack. And at bedroom volume it will never feel exactly like the record. That album sound is also double/quad-tracked guitars, bass, mix EQ, compression, and aggressive picking. The Katana can get in the ballpark, but the record tone is not just one amp setting.
